The College Press offers internship positions to
passionate students eager to advance in the world
of mass communications. The College Press is
currently the fastest growing online journalism
network on the web. The TCP network offers a
variety of positions for students to fill in order to
receive college credit as well as to prepare themselves
for their future media careers.

 

Intern positions currently available: 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

two students with a pencil

Editing:

 
This position is for those who are skilled in editing. With articles coming in everyday, the network needs talented copy editors to help ensure the published work remains top quality.

Marketing/PR:

 

The College Press network needs brilliant young minds to help spread  the word about the network and its incredible features. This position is for those who are outgoing and can communicate well with others. Students in this position will be handling company advertising accounts, public relations and media connections for the entire network.

Publishing:

 

This position is for those students who would like to help publish the network content. The College Press is updated several times per day with news from all over the world. Students helping the network publish will be able to control what the world sees in these pages on a daily basis.

Training:

 

The College Press is looking for interns to help train newly hired interns and staff. TCP has certain rules, guidelines and understandings with staff.  Students in this position will help train new recruits to the TCP network.

Member Care:

 

The College Press was created to help students succeed and progress. The TCP network is very large and can sometimes confuse new members. Interns in this position will be responsible for nurturing new members, assisting them in starting their profiles and troubleshooting situations with members who may have problems learning  network features. This is a full service position that is all about network members and making sure they are happy.
